Vice President - Capital Adequacy & Reporting - Bank

10 - 12 Years.Mumbai

Our Client is world's leading banks and provides its clients with investment banking, private banking, and asset management services worldwide. They are hiring for VP- Capital Adequacy Reporting to be part of their global banking team

The candidate will lead the UK Capital Reporting team in India covering the preparation and review of Regulatory Returns to the PRA The candidate will be managing a team of 12 to 15 people

Core responsibilities of the Capital Reporting :

- Preparation of periodical reg. returns for systemically important Legal Entities in UK. The activities include Daily monitoring and preparation of capital adequacy and large exposures reports, etc.

- Interpretation of the Regulatory rules which forms the basis of PRA reporting and providing regulatory guidance to the business.

- Partnership and supporting other Finance areas with other reporting requirements (e.g. recovery and resolution, ICAAP)

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ES :

- Review and sign off on Capital Returns to be submitted to the PRA

- Review and sign off on Capital Adequacy Reporting

- Working closely with legal entity, regulatory, treasury, risk and finance team of day-to-day activities and support them with adhoc requests.

- Maintain a thorough understanding of UK Basel III capital requirements and regulatory reporting requirements

- Ensure preparation and execution of close process for RWA and Regulatory capital production and effective communication and coordination with other actors involved in the close process

- Ensure consistency of exposures between the Accounting and the Risk or other source systems for calculation of RWA

- Strong regulatory & financial reporting knowledge prevalent in banking/financial institutions

ROLE REQUIREMENTS :

- Chartered Accountant (CA)

- 10-12 years of experience in banking within preferably in Regulatory Reporting / Capital

- Good academics and strong knowledge of Capital Concepts

- Has prior experience of managing a team delivering Capital Reports.

- Excellent communication and inter-personal skills

- Strong Analytical and problem solver person.

- Strong stakeholder management skills
